US wholesale inventories in July were revised down to a 0.1% increase, showing businesses are cautious about restocking after significant reductions in the previous quarter. While inventories of motor vehicles fell by 1.6%, apparel and grocery stocks saw increases of 1.9% and 2.0%, respectively. Overall, sales at wholesalers rose by 1.4% in July, indicating a slight improvement in market activity.
